So I'm sure this has been discussed before! But DH and I just decded to visit his brother's family for Thanksgiving. We'd fly from Baltimore to Atlanta (about 2 hours direct flight), and then rent a car and drive another 2 hours.
So ...
1. To save money, I don't plan on buying DD a ticket. I can have her sit on our laps (since she's under two). We flew with DD once before when she was about 2-3 months old. And at that time I had no problem keeping her on my lap! She pretty much BFed the whole time! But now that she's active and walking I'm worried that I'm crazy to hold her on my lap for 2 hours! Even if it were around her BFing/nap time, I think she'd be more interested in all the people around her to BF or nap. Am I crazy to attempt to hold her for 2 hours?
2. If she refuses to BF during take off and landing, how can I make sure the pressure doesn't bother her ears?
3. What's the differance between checking the carseat at the gate versus checking it curbside? I plan to take one with us so I don't have to rent a nasty one at the car rental place. I'm thinking if I check at the gate, and there just happens to be an extra seat in our row, I may be able to put the seat on the plane. I'm worried about cheking curbsite because I don't want it tossed around alot on all their conveyor belts! I'm guessing if it were checked at the gate it wouldn't be tossed around as much?

2. DD still uses a paci for sleeping, so if she doesn't nurse I give her that. Or a sippy because it still requires a sucking motion. 3. I will never check a carseat at the ticket counter/curbside because a friend did that and the carseats were put on the wrong flight. So she was at her destination with no way to leave the airport because her kiddos didn't have seats. Plus I feel like the carseat gets tossed around less since at the gate it's one of the last things on and first things off. It is a hassle to lug it through the airport though.

Yes, I think you're crazy to attempt to hold her at this age rather than buying her a seat. But then, I have never flown without a seat and DD's carseat, even when she was 2 months old. It is nice to have the space, she sleeps so much better in her carseat than on me, and then I don't have to worry about the carseat getting beat up while checked, or renting one at my destination that may not be in good shape. For us, the extra seat is well worth the money.
Also, I know it's standard advice to feed during takeoff and landing because of the ear issue, but DD never cared one way or the other. I would just bring a snack and sippy cup just in case.
We have never had an issue with the pressure. She has slept through a few takeoffs without eating or sucking on anything, and it was fine. We have always gate checked car seats.
The key to happy flights for us is SNACKS. Giving her puffs and wagon wheels keeps her happy/busy for a good amount of time. I let her play with my cell phone and watch videos of herself. I packed a backpack full of dollar store toys that she had never seen before. Good luck!
